Why Do You Need a Practical Tools Drawer?
A chaotic work space can prevent your productivity and make the easiest tasks feel overwhelming. By investing in a sensible tools drawer, you can transform your chaotic space into an arranged sanctuary. Here are some reasons that a tools drawer is crucial for every work space:
Efficiency: With all your tools neatly saved in a devoted cabinet, you will not waste time searching for what you need. Every tool will have its designated area, making it simple to discover and access when required.
Safety: Storing your tools in a cabinet maintains them out of reach from kids or pet dogs who might accidentally injure themselves. It additionally stops prospective crashes triggered by locating scattered tools.
Space-saving: A tools drawer permits you to maximize the available space in your work space. Rather than leaving your tools spread on kitchen counters or racks, they can be nicely concealed, maximizing beneficial surface area area.
Durability: Correctly keeping your tools in a specialized cabinet assists protect them from damage brought on by exposure to dust, wetness, or unexpected drops. This ensures their longevity and saves you money on regular replacements.
How to Choose the Right Tools Drawer
Now that we comprehend the relevance of having a practical tools drawer, it's essential to pick one that suits your demands. Below are some variables to think about when picking the perfect tools drawer for your work space:
Size and Capacity
Before purchasing a tools drawer, evaluate the dimension of your tool collection and figure out how much storage room you call for. Think about the dimensions of the drawer along with its weight-bearing capacity to ensure it can suit your tools without overcrowding or compromising functionality.
Material and Construction
Opt for a tools drawer made from durable products such as steel or top notch plastic. These products are strong, resistant to damage, and can hold up against the weight of heavy tools. In addition, try to find cabinets with smooth moving systems to guarantee easy opening and closing.
Organization Features

These functions allow you to classify and separate your tools based on size, kind, or regularity of usage, making it much easier to locate them promptly when needed.
